Rebecca Shabad is a politics reporter for NBC News based in Washington.

WASHINGTON — Rep. Zach Nunn, R-Iowa, expressed frustration on Thursday that the failure by House Republicans to coalesce around a candidate for speaker is taking away from time that could be spent addressing the Israel-Hamas war. The first-term lawmaker spoke to reporters after a closed-door House Republican Conference meeting as members grapple with trying to find a candidate who could be elected speaker in a floor vote.

, as speaker, House Republicans have been struggling to pick a successor who would have enough support to be elected during a formal floor vote. On Wednesday, House Majority Leader Steve Scalise, R-La., won an internal election for speaker in a 113-99 vote, but he will need 217 votes to win on the House floor.
